It's Halloween in Buttercup, Texas, and reporter-turned-farmer Lucy Resnick is up to her ears in more than goats and wayward cows. Not only has her well dried up, but it turns out the old house Lucy recently moved to the farm has a reputation for spooks... and they are disturbingly active. Then a Tarot card reading at a local mead winery foretells death... only to have exotic game ranch owner Bug Wharton turn up dead. Cause of death? Murder, by a fatal dose of bee venom. When the dimwitted sheriff fingers local witch and mead winery owner Selena Gutierrez, Lucy gets involved... and soon discovers that all kinds of things are brewing in Buttercup.
Nearly everyone in Buttercup is looking forward to two things, the Halloween party at the local Mead producers and Rain - lots of rain! There has been a major drought and now Lucy's well has dried up, she puts her panic over the water situation on hold until post the party, but no one expects the fireworks they get, a local man made good (Bug Wharton) has bought a farm nearby and has turned it into an exotic game ranch, leading to a collision course between him, the Wiccan Mead maker (Selena) and Peter one of the volunteer firemen. That should have been the end of it but later that evening Bug is found to be having an anaphylactic attack and even though he is given adreneline he winds up dead.
Now the local Sheriff has decided that Selena is guilty of murder (apparently with no evidence pointing to her!) so Lucy dusts off her Investigative reporter hat and starts to hunt for the real killer!
